What Causes Chronic Knee Pain?
Chronic knee pain can develop from a variety of conditions, including:
- Osteoarthritis
- Joint degeneration
- Tendon injuries
- Ligament injuries
- Meniscus damage
- Previous knee trauma
- Repetitive stress injuries
- Muscle imbalances
- Inflammation around the joint
Because the knee is one of the most heavily used joints in the body, wear and tear can gradually lead to pain, stiffness, and reduced mobility over time.
Common Symptoms of Chronic Knee Pain
Many patients experience symptoms such as:
- Persistent aching in the knee
- Swelling and inflammation
- Difficulty walking
- Knee stiffness
- Limited range of motion
- Pain when climbing stairs
- Grinding or popping sensations
- Instability or weakness in the knee
These symptoms often worsen without proper treatment and can significantly impact quality of life.
